Quad LVDS receiver with flow-through pinout 16-TSSOP -40 to 85
|
Pbfree Code | Yes | |
Rohs Code | Yes | |
Part Life Cycle Code | Active | |
Ihs Manufacturer | TEXAS INSTRUMENTS INC | |
Part Package Code | TSSOP | |
Package Description | GREEN, TSSOP-16 | |
Pin Count | 16 | |
Reach Compliance Code | compliant | |
ECCN Code | EAR99 | |
HTS Code | 8542.39.00.01 | |
Samacsys Manufacturer | Texas Instruments | |
Driver Number of Bits | 4 | |
Input Characteristics | DIFFERENTIAL | |
Interface IC Type | LINE RECEIVER | |
Interface Standard | EIA-644; TIA-644 | |
JESD-30 Code | R-PDSO-G16 | |
JESD-609 Code | e4 | |
Length | 5 mm | |
Moisture Sensitivity Level | 1 | |
Number of Functions | 4 | |
Number of Terminals | 16 | |
Operating Temperature-Max | 85 °C | |
Operating Temperature-Min | -40 °C | |
Output Characteristics | 3-STATE | |
Output Low Current-Max | 0.002 A | |
Output Polarity | TRUE | |
Package Body Material | PLASTIC/EPOXY | |
Package Code | TSSOP | |
Package Equivalence Code | TSSOP16,.25 | |
Package Shape | RECTANGULAR | |
Package Style | SMALL OUTLINE, THIN PROFILE, SHRINK PITCH | |
Peak Reflow Temperature (Cel) | 260 | |
Qualification Status | Not Qualified | |
Receive Delay-Max | 3.7 ns | |
Receiver Number of Bits | 4 | |
Seated Height-Max | 1.2 mm | |
Supply Current-Max | 15 mA | |
Supply Voltage-Max | 3.6 V | |
Supply Voltage-Min | 3 V | |
Supply Voltage-Nom | 3.3 V | |
Supply Voltage1-Max | 3.6 V | |
Supply Voltage1-Min | 3 V | |
Supply Voltage1-Nom | 3.3 V | |
Surface Mount | YES | |
Technology | CMOS | |
Temperature Grade | INDUSTRIAL | |
Terminal Finish | Nickel/Palladium/Gold (Ni/Pd/Au) | |
Terminal Form | GULL WING | |
Terminal Pitch | 0.65 mm | |
Terminal Position | DUAL | |
Time@Peak Reflow Temperature-Max (s) | 30 | |
Width | 4.4 mm |
